Description
Studio portrait of 2255 Private (Pte) John Samuel Stockdale, 46th Battalion from South Yarra, Melbourne, Victoria. A 44 year old driver prior to enlisting on 22 March 1916, he embarked for overseas with the 4th Reinforcements from Melbourne on 16 August 1916 aboard HMAT Orontes. After further training in England, he joined the Battalion in France in November 1916. He was wounded in action near Zonnebeeke, Belgium on 11 October 1917 and died from his wounds the next day. Pte Stockdale is buried in the Lijssenthoek Military Cemetery, Belgium.
